1.1 INTRODUCTION
SBM has been requested to implement a number of changes into the existing FPSOESPIRITO SANTO located in the Shell BC-10 Development offshore Brazil which has beenin operation since year 2009. The planned development of Phase 3 includes new subseainfrastructure as well as topsides installation which covers the development of the Massa andO-South fields.
The BC-10 Phase 3 project has been split into several CTRs:
CTR 31Water injection system expansion of additional 40,000 bwpd and water injectionpressure increase to 2505 psig due to Massa water injection daisy chained fromO-north
CTR 32Convert off-spec tank to additional hot oil storage due to additional displacementvolume and longer hot oil durations
CTR 33Expand oil treating capacity train B from 25,000 bopd to 35,000 bopd required forPhase 3 early oil peak rates
CTR 34CO2 mitigation plan as sales gas has exceeded the CO2 limits of the Sales GasContract

2. BASE SCOPE
This document defines the Scope of Work (SOW) and deliverables requirementsnecessary to confirm necessity to reinforce tanks following BC10 Phase 3 scopeinstallation offshore.
The survey shall cover two areas:
Module 49 (above tanks: 4C, 4AS and may be 3C and 3BS to be confirmed)
Module 10B (above tanks 1WS and 1AS and sponson 1S)

2.2 CONTACTOR RESPONSIBILITY
The CONTRACTOR shall:
a) Be responsible for all services including but not limited to the provision of thesurvey of fillet weld thickness (throat) equipment, qualified and experiencedoperators (including certified PTW applicant), quality control, planning, pre-surveydata gathering and preparations, site coordination, progress reporting,consolidation and processing of survey data, and submission of final work report.
b) Be responsible to request PURCHASER any information such as drawings foundsto be missing to ensure complete understanding of the scope of work.
c) Provide PURCHASER with a method statement describing how CONTRACTORintends to perform the scope of work (equipment, accuracy, access to location,
safety measures, schedule of operation and tank access requirement, etc)d) Be responsible for the MOB / DEMOB of equipment enroute to Shore base inVitoria.

3. SAFETY
The facility to where thickness survey is required is in operation. CONTRACTOR shall
participate in site specific safety programs. CONTRACTOR shall not cause anyinterruptions to the operation of the facility, and shall obtain necessary permits andpermissions to execute the work.

8. QUALITY ASSURANCE
The CONTRACTOR shall fully implement effective Quality Assurance in accordance withISO 9001/9002 and including all relevant requirements of their associated guidancedocument ISO 9004.
As part of this Quality Assurance the CONTRACTOR shall develop his Quality System soas to include identification and procedural detailing of all necessary interfaces,responsibilities and activities required within the CONTRACT.
